I don't believe it's covered by OHIP (at least it wasn't a few years ago). The costs are around $15,000 to $20,000 per year. You can try applying for assistance with these costs through the Trillium program.

That isn’t how it works. Trillium follows the ODB formulary. You would need to be eligible for trillium. Your use of Humira should have come up a long time ago during your medicals. The percentage you may get covered will be based on last year’s income (international included). It is supposed to coverage high drug charges based on your ability to afford your cash payments. You still pay a decent amount if you make any form of income. Private coverage covers more drugs and for more indications. To receive expensive drugs you usually have to exclude other less expensive medications and be covered by the indication the ODB feels like they want to cover. For example it will only cover a certain anti-nausea medication for palliative cancer patients. Others can use it but either must pay or have private coverage that will pay.
